EHS Facilities & Security Leader

GE Renewable Energy Power and Aviation
West Chester, PA
Job Description Summary

The TAVS EHS, Facilities & Security Leader is accountable for shaping and executing the Operational Safety, EHS, Facilities, and Security strategy for all TAVS shops. This leader provides functional oversight to the EHS, Facilities, and physical Security across the Turbine and Airfoil Value Stream (TAVS) Part Family, ensuring GE Aerospace EHS, Facilities, and Security policies and practices are rigorously followed and continuously improved across all locations.

The role will define the strategic vision and operational framework for best-in-class performance in industrial safety, environmental stewardship, facilities management, and security, while driving a strong zero-incident culture and safe, reliable, and compliant facilities across all TAVS locations. This position may be based remote or in West Chester, OH.

This position will require up to 80% travel.

Job Description

Roles and Responsibilities

Functional EHS, Facilities & Security leadership for TAVS
  • Provide oversight and indirect leadership for the EHS, Facilities, and Security functions within the Turbine and Airfoil Value Stream (TAVS) Part Family, spanning multiple sites.
  • Coach and mentor site EHS and Facilities leaders and broader site teams within TAVS to drive consistent standards and best practices.

Operational Safety, EHS, Facilities & Security strategy
  • Partner across TAVS sites to characterize and predict risk, fortify layers of protection, and validate defenses to support a zero-incident culture and resilient facilities and security posture.
  • Establish and Drive Daily Management rigor and connectivity across all locations.
  • Partner with TAVS leadership to establish, monitor, and manage Operational Safety, EHS, Facilities, and Security KPIs.

Management of Change and standard work
  • Drive rigorous Management of Change (MOC) processes for system-altering and risk-significant changes across sites, including changes impacting safety, environment, facilities, and security.
  • Establish and ensure adherence to Operational Safety, EHS, Facilities, and Security Standard Work (for example, risk mapping, defense strength reviews, process hazard assessments, site security standards, and critical facility infrastructure procedures).

Facilities and Security oversight (multi-site)
  • Provide multi-site oversight of facilities operations, ensuring safe, reliable, and compliant building and infrastructure performance across all TAVS locations.
  • Ensure business continuity and resiliency planning for facilities and security, including emergency response, crisis management, and disaster recovery coordination with site and functional leaders.
  • Partner with sourcing, real estate, IT, and other enabling functions to plan and execute facilities projects, security system upgrades, and capital investments in a safe, compliant, and cost-effective manner.

Continuous improvement
  • Lead EHS and Facilities/Security daily management routines across TAVS shops to drive visibility to risk, issues, and performance.
  • Facilitate Problem Solving, Action Planning, and Kaizen events to continuously improve Operational Safety, EHS, Facilities, and Security performance.
  • Interpret internal and external business challenges and recommend best practices, leveraging industry, regulatory, and security trends.

Compliance and governance
  • Partner with site leaders to drive adherence to GE Aerospace processes, policies, and standards, and applicable laws and regulations related to EHS, Facilities, and Security.
  • Align with and help evolve the GE Aerospace EHS and Security frameworks from a TAVS perspective, ensuring site-level implementation and feedback.
  • Influence effectively in a highly matrixed environment across operations, engineering, supply chain, real estate, sourcing, IT, and other functions.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university (or a high school diploma / GED with a minimum of 4 years of EHS and/or Facilities leadership experience in a manufacturing and/or production environment )
  • At least an additional 5 years of EHS and/or Facilities leadership experience in a manufacturing and/or production environment

Desired Characteristics:

  • Master's Degree from an accredited college or institution
  • Certified Safety Professional (CSP) and/or Certified Industrial Hygienist (CIH)
  • Extensive EHS leadership experience in manufacturing/production
  • Experience in multi-site facilities management and/or security leadership in an industrial environment
  • Strong familiarity with EHS risks associated with machining and industrial processes
  • Working knowledge of the GE Aerospace EHS framework and exposure to corporate Security standards and practices
  • Experience leading in a highly matrixed environment and driving cultural transformation
  • Exposure to Lean tools, methods, and terminology
